![]() However, people still sometimes use it to describe the luminous intensity of high powered flashlights and spotlights. "Candlepower" is largely an obsolete term. Then they calculated the candlepower of the lamp under test from the two distances and the inverse square law. They adjusted the distance of one of the lamps until the two surfaces appeared to be of equal brightness. To measure the candlepower of a lamp, a person judged by eye the relative brightness of adjacent surfaces-one illuminated only by a standard lamp (or candle) and the other only by the lamp under test. In general modern use, a candlepower now equates directly (1:1) to the number of candelas -an implicit increase from its old value. One candlepower unit is about 0.981 candela. In 1948, the international unit ( SI) candela replaced candlepower. In 1937, the international candle was redefined again-against the luminous intensity of a blackbody at the freezing point of liquid platinum which was to be 58.9 international candles per square centimetre. In 1921, the Commission Internationale de l'Eclairage (International Commission for Illumination, commonly referred to as the CIE) redefined the international candle again in terms of a carbon filament incandescent lamp. The Germans, however, dissented and decided to use a definition equal to 9/10 of the output of a Hefner lamp. The majority redefined the candle in term of an electric lamp with a carbon filament. It was attended by representatives of the Laboratoire Central de l’Electricité (France), the National Physical Laboratory (UK), the Bureau of Standards (United States), and the Physikalische Technische Reichsanstalt (Germany). In 1909, several agencies met to establish an international standard. Ten standard candles equaled about one Carcel burner. They defined the unit was that illumination that emanates from a lamp burning pure colza oil (obtained from the seed of the plant Brassica campestris) at a defined rate. Spermaceti is a material from the heads of sperm whales, and was once used to make high-quality candles.Īt the time the UK established candlepower as a unit, the French standard of light was based on the illumination from a Carcel burner. The term candlepower was originally defined in the United Kingdom, by the Metropolitan Gas Act 1860, as the light produced by a pure spermaceti candle that weighs 1⁄ 6 pound (76 grams) and burns at a rate of 120 grains per hour (7.8 grams per hour). In modern usage, candlepower is sometimes used as a synonym for candela. The historical candlepower is equal to 0.981 candelas. It expresses levels of light intensity relative to the light emitted by a candle of specific size and constituents. The candlepower was based on the light emitted from a candleĬandlepower (abbreviated as cp or CP) is a unit of measurement for luminous intensity. ![]()
